Buck Mason Maverick Slim Officer Pant
Modeled after a vintage pair of US Army officerโs pants, Buck Masonโs classy and well-made take on a chino has buy-it-for-life quality and a great look and feel.
The 8.9-ounce cotton twill material is just the right weight for year-round wear.
The Mavericks fit slim through the thigh and taper near the ankles, making them an excellent choice for wearing to the office or out on a date.

Relwen Flyweight Flex Chino Pant
Lightweight and built to move around in, Relwenโs Flyweight Flex Chino Pants are an outdoor-ready option in this classic pant style.
Theyโre made with plenty of stretch courtesy of three percent spandex in their material blend and are further equipped with pleated knees and a gusseted crotch for a greater range of motion.
With these, you can look great and be ready for action at the same time.

Dickies Original 874 Work Pant
For no-nonsense, ridiculously affordable chinos, look no further than the Dickies Original 874 Work Pant.
The sturdy poly/cotton twill fabric is made more for durability than comfort, but they still break in nicely after a few months of wear.
Theyโre available in 20 colors, and more waist and inseam sizes than any other chinos on the market. And you can get three to five pairs of these Dickies for the cost of a single pair of designer chinos.
Jack Donnelly Twill Straight Chino M2
Inspired by the original WWII-era chino pants, Jack Donnellyโs Twill Straight M2 Chinos are proudly made in America, and built to last.
Theyโre made from an 8.5-ounce cotton twill thatโs great for year-round wear, and tough enough to last a decade or more.
Cut with a just-right fit thatโs neither slim nor generous, they harken back to the golden ages of American manufacturing and style.

What is the difference between chinos and khakis?
Thereโs no hard and fast rule for the difference between chinos and khakis โ but khakis are usually more utilitarian and work-oriented, while chinos can have dressier lines and slimmer fits.
